I have a problem with the article noting the preference for and consequent desire for lighter skin in Thai and other Asian societies as being 'racism.' This is class based not racial – as the article itself notes farmers and other people on the lower rungs of the social ladder have darker skin color. In other words primarily people who do manual labor out in the sun – ancestry/genetics would have a part, but we aren't looking at anything like racism. |
